Thunderstorms are delaying flights and disrupting travel at the three major New York City area airports.
The FAA says storms moving through the area Friday evening are holding up some flights headed for Newark and La Guardia more than 4 hours.

Flights headed for Kennedy are delayed an average of 3 hours, 46 minutes.
The FAA says departures from Newark and La Guardia are delayed around 2 hours. Departures from Kennedy are delayed up to 90 minutes.
The agency says those delays are increasing as the storms continue to roll through the area throughout the evening
A flash flood warning is in effect until 8:15 p.m. for all of New York City, until 8 p.m. for Northern New Jersey and 9:30 p.m. for Middlesex County, New Jersey
